How to fill out the Idaho Bar Application Reciprocal Fillable Form online
This guide provides a comprehensive and user-friendly approach to completing the Idaho Bar Application Reciprocal Fillable Form online. By following these simple steps, you can ensure that your application is filled out accurately and efficiently.
Follow the steps to successfully complete your form.
- Click the 'Get Form' button to obtain the form and open it for editing.
- Begin by entering your full name in the designated fields. Ensure that you include your first name, middle name (if applicable), last name, and any suffix. It is important to print your name exactly how you would like it to appear on your certificate from the Idaho Supreme Court.
- Provide your social security number. Remember that furnishing this information is voluntary, but it will be used for investigation and verification purposes.
- Fill out your mailing address for all official correspondence. Be sure to include your street or box number, city, state, zip code, daytime telephone number, and email address. Notify the Idaho State Bar of any future address changes.
- Input the date you are submitting your application and the fee amount of $1000. Make sure to follow payment instructions, ensuring checks are made payable to the Idaho State Bar.
- Provide your date of birth and birthplace. Indicate your gender using the provided options.
- If you have ever been known by any other name, answer accordingly and provide an explanation, including exact dates, if applicable.
- List your residences over the past ten years in reverse chronological order, ensuring there are no gaps between dates.
- Detail your education history by listing colleges and universities attended, along with the degree granted. Follow this by listing all law schools attended, especially the one where you earned your Juris Doctor degree.
- Indicate your current employment status and provide details about your current and past employment for the last ten years.
- Complete the military service section if applicable, providing necessary details about your service.
- Fill out the sections regarding previous bar applications, admissions, and any examinations taken.
- Complete the law practice section, ensuring to provide up-to-date certificates of good standing from any jurisdictions you’ve practiced in.
- Provide references and detail your character and fitness, ensuring you are thorough and accurate in your responses.
- Review your completed application carefully for accuracy and completeness. Once finalized, save your changes. You can then print, download, or share the form as needed.
